Urban water demand is expected ... Water shortage is a growing problem for most countries in the world. For China, which has 20% of world’s population and only 7% of available water resources, this problem may become catastrophic (Hofstedt 2010, 72). Therefore some actions and measures should be performed to avoid or at least to weaken future water crisis in China.

The situation is not sustainable. Though the south has abundant water, there is a lack of clean water due to serious water pollution.

Currently, China’s South-to-North water diversion project is providing the bulk of Beijing’s water supply. The project, which is two-thirds complete, comprises of three massive aqueducts. The project is expected to reach maximum capacity in 2019, but China’s water demand is increasing so quickly that additional solutions will be needed.

A total of 28.8% and 32.0% of China’s area suffer WSqua and WScom (WSqua > 1 and WScom > 1, see methods for the equations), respectively. Water scarce areas are mainly distributed in North China. Over half areas in the Huai, Hai, Yellow, and Liao River basins, and 45.4% areas in the Songhua River basin are under WScom.16 de out. de 2020 ...
